itip, scotty: Add help texts for arguments
authorThomas Perl <m@thp.io>
Thu, 29 Sep 2011 11:38:37 +0000 (13:38 +0200)
committerThomas Perl <m@thp.io>
Thu, 29 Sep 2011 11:38:37 +0000 (13:38 +0200)
itip
scotty

diff --git a/itip b/itip
index 7450384..57c5b11 100755 (executable)
--- a/itip
+++ b/itip
@@ -15,8 +15,8 @@ def inblue(x):
     return '\033[94m' + x + '\033[0m'
 
 parser = argparse.ArgumentParser(description='Get realtime public transport information for Vienna')
-parser.add_argument('line', nargs='?')
-parser.add_argument('station', nargs='?')
+parser.add_argument('line', nargs='?', help='line name (e.g. 59A)')
+parser.add_argument('station', nargs='?', help='station name (e.g. Karlsplatz)')
 
 args = parser.parse_args()
 
diff --git a/scotty b/scotty
index d3a9f1b..8ad87be 100755 (executable)
--- a/scotty
+++ b/scotty
@@ -9,8 +9,8 @@ from gotovienna.routing import *
 parser = argparse.ArgumentParser(description='Get public transport route for Vienna')
 parser.add_argument('-ot', metavar='type', type=str, help='origin type: %s' % ' | '.join(POSITION_TYPES), default='stop', choices=POSITION_TYPES)
 parser.add_argument('-dt', metavar='type', type=str, help='destination type: %s' % ' | '.join(POSITION_TYPES), default='stop', choices=POSITION_TYPES)
-parser.add_argument('origin', nargs='?')
-parser.add_argument('destination', nargs='?')
+parser.add_argument('origin', nargs='?', help='origin station name')
+parser.add_argument('destination', nargs='?', help='destination station name')
 
 args = parser.parse_args()